Nottingham Forest suffered a 1-0 defeat at Wigan Athletic on Sunday and Rafa Mir was one of many players to come in for criticism from supporters.

The 22-year-old has been short of form, fitness and playing time since joining on loan from Wolverhampton Wanderers, but he was handed a rare start by Sabri Lamouchi after the international break.

Unfortunately, Mir failed to impress at the DW Stadium and may find himself dropped when Forest lock horns with Hull City on October 23.

Against Wigan, the striker played for 54 minutes, made 17 touches, won two aerial duels, completed 50% of his eight passes, had five shots with 20% accuracy and completed two dribbles.

As per Transfermarkt, Mir has made eight appearances in all competitions for the Reds, making two assists. He’s failed to get off the mark in his 305 minutes of football, however, and isn’t look like an effective signing by Forest.

Karim Ansarifard, Apostolos Vellios, Jason Cummings, Daryl Murphy and Hillal Soudani were all offloaded over the summer, so Lamouchi may have to seek out another attacker in the January transfer window as Mir isn’t cutting it.
